At long last, HBO is finally inviting audiences to pledge their allegiance as the internal strife among the warring Targaryen factions reach a crescendo: are you Team Black or Team Green?
With House of the Dragon Season 2’s return at hand, HBO is encapsulating this difficult choice with, not just one but two trailers, which comes roughly 24 hours after it unveiled a series of character posters ahead of its release.
The pair of House of the Dragon Season 2 trailers offer a glimpse into the fierce rivalry that promises to engulf the Seven Kingdoms, told across eight episodes starting on June 16.
Building upon the dramatic events of House of the Dragon‘s debut season, the conflict at the heart of Season 2 escalates following the tragic demise of Lucerys, lighting a fuse under the already tense parties and speeding up the inevitable Dance of the Dragons. This civil war marks a decades-long battle between kin, famously regarded as the most devastating to the realm and to the dragons that have come to symbolize the power of House Targaryen.
The two trailers released by HBO serve to delineate the battle lines between the warring factions within the Targaryen house. Team Black, rallying under the sigil of the “Crown’s Delight” Princess Rhaenyra Targaryen, portrayed by Emma D’Arcy, along with her Prince Consort Daemon Targaryen, played by Matt Smith, stands for the claim of Rhaenyra to the Iron Throne, as decreed by her late father, King Viserys. On the opposite side, Team Green supports the usurper Aegon Targaryen, the son of Queen Alicent Hightower, bringing to the forefront the internal conflicts and betrayals that have plagued the dynasty.

The choice between Team Black and Team Green is representative of divergent visions for the future of Westeros. Team Black champions a progressive claim by a woman to the throne, challenging the patriarchal Westerosi norms. In contrast, Team Green’s claim reinforces traditional succession through male heirs, a conflict that resonates with contemporary debates on governance and succession.
